Whirlwind (David Cannon) is a Marvel Comics super-villain with the mutant ability to spin at superhuman speeds, initially appearing as the Human Top. He is known for his obsessive infatuation with Janet van Dyne (the Wasp), his membership in the Masters of Evil and Lethal Legion, and frequent conflicts with Ant-Man and the Avengers.
